Transaction 75b7f879fa23d21c463aaff7ce23405b225e757e932017979176370538d5b35c

1 Input
2 Outputs
  • 75b7f879fa23d21c463aaff7ce23405b225e757e932017979176370538d5b35c:0
  • value  973850
    address  1DWJanywFNfRWvBBn9aLLFX58buMbe4mSs
  • 75b7f879fa23d21c463aaff7ce23405b225e757e932017979176370538d5b35c:1
  • value  5476677
    address  37tN6EtYzsorm6zBcpfWz8w5xRNy3mab33